If you notice the message “TikTok sound removed due to copyright,” it means the platform has taken down the audio from your video because it was flagged as copyrighted content.

TikTok uses automated systems to detect music and audio that may be protected by copyright laws. When such audio is found without proper licensing, TikTok removes the sound to comply with copyright regulations.

Although your video might still remain on your profile, the original sound will no longer play for viewers.

Why TikTok Removes Sound for Copyright

Several reasons can cause this issue on TikTok.

1. Uploading Copyrighted Music

If you upload a video containing a song that TikTok does not have licensing rights to, the platform may remove the audio.

This often happens when creators add music using external editing apps.


2. Using Audio From Movies or TV Shows

Audio clips taken from:

  • Movies
  • TV shows
  • Streaming platforms
  • Music videos

are usually copyrighted and may trigger TikTok’s copyright detection system.


3. Music Restrictions by Region

Some songs are licensed only in certain countries. If the audio is not licensed in your region, TikTok may remove it.


4. Copyright Owner Requests

Sometimes music owners request platforms like TikTok to remove their copyrighted content when used without permission.


What Happens After TikTok Removes the Sound

When TikTok removes audio due to copyright:

  • The video remains on your profile
  • The sound track is removed
  • Viewers may hear silence or replacement audio
  • Video engagement may decrease

Sound is a major part of TikTok videos, so removing it can affect performance.


How to Fix TikTok Sound Removed Due to Copyright

If your video has lost its sound, try these solutions.

Replace the Audio

You can replace the removed sound with a licensed track from TikTok’s music library.


Reupload the Video With Safe Audio

Delete the muted video and upload it again using:

  • TikTok-approved music
  • Original voiceover
  • Royalty-free audio

Create Original Sounds

Original audio created by you usually avoids copyright problems and can even become a trending sound on TikTok.


Tips to Avoid Copyright Problems on TikTok

To prevent audio removal in the future:

  • Use music from TikTok’s built-in sound library
  • Avoid adding copyrighted songs during external editing
  • Use royalty-free or original audio
  • Check music permissions before uploading videos

These practices help keep your content compliant with TikTok rules.
